To diminish the speckle effect of a laser projection system, an LCoS spatial light modulator was employed to replace the commonly‐used diffuser and beam shaping components. The speckle contrast was reduced from 0.887 to 0.315, the image quality was greatly improved, and the system complexity was decreased as well.
